개발자

주니어 백엔드 개발자 공부 서적 추천 부탁 드립니다.

2024년 06월 17일조회 140

경력 6개월 차...이고요 다름이 아니고 제가 좀 아키텍처를 설계하는 능력이 부족하고 코드를 정리하는 능력이 부족해서 좀 키워보려고 하는데요 그래서 클린 아키텍처라는 서적과 소프트웨어 아키텍처 101라는 서적 중에 고민 중입니다. 혹은 다른 필독서 있다면 추천해 주시면 감사하겠습니다~

이 질문이 도움이 되었나요?
'추천해요' 버튼을 누르면 좋은 질문이 더 많은 사람에게 노출될 수 있어요. '보충이 필요해요' 버튼을 누르면 질문자에게 질문 내용 보충을 요청하는 알림이 가요.
profile picture
익명님의 질문

답변 1

포크코딩님의 프로필 사진

개발하신지 반년이니 아래 두 권 추천 드립니다. <객체지향 사실과 오해>, <오브젝트> 조영호 저

지금 가입하면 모든 질문의 답변을 볼 수 있어요!

현직자들의 명쾌한 답변을 얻을 수 있어요.

또는

이미 회원이신가요?

AI 답변
커리어리 AI 봇 프로필 이미지

커리어리 AI 봇

GPT가 달아주는 답변입니다.

2024년 06월 17일

주니어 백엔드 개발자로서 아키텍처와 코드 정리 능력을 향상시키기 위해 서적을 찾고 계시군요. 1. "클린 아키텍처" - 로버트 C. 마틴: 이 책은 소프트웨어 설계에 대한 깊이 있는 이해를 제공합니다. '클린 코드'와 '클린 코더'의 저자로 잘 알려진 로버트 C. 마틴이 제공하는 가장 좋은 설계 패턴, 도구, 기술들에 대해 배울 수 있습니다. 2. "소프트웨어 아키텍처 101" - 에릭 에반스: DDD(Domain-Driven Design)의 개념을 간단하게 설명하며, 소프트웨어 아키텍처에 대한 철학과 방법론을 소개합니다. 그 외 추가적으로 추천드리고 싶은 서적들은: 3. "Design Patterns: Elements of Reusable Object-Oriented Software" - GoF(Gang of Four): 디자인 패턴에 대한 classic인 이 책은 객체 지향 프로그래밍과 디자인 패턴을 깊게 이해하는 데 도움이 될 것입니다. 4. "Refactoring: Improving the Design of Existing Code" - Martin Fowler: 코드의 구조를 개선해 가독성을 높이고 유지보수를 용이하게 하는 방법에 대해 상세히 설명합니다. 5. "Domain-Driven Design: Tackling Complexity in the Heart of Software" - Eric Evans: 복잡한 소프트웨어 시스템을 위한 디자인 접근법을 제시합니다. 주어진 시간과 상황에 따라 이 서적들 중 선택하셔서 공부하시면 아키텍처와 코드 정리 능력 향상에 도움이 될 것입니다.

목록으로

지금 가입하면 모든 질문의 답변을 볼 수 있어요!